About Andrew Sobczyk

Andrew Sobczyk is a scholar working on Geometry and Topology, Applied Mathematics, Mathematical Physics, Computer Graphics and Computer-Aided Design and Discrete Mathematics and Combinatorics, having authored 20 papers that have together received 81 indexed citations. Recurring topics across this work include Mathematics and Applications (5 papers), Computational Geometry and Mesh Generation (3 papers), Mathematical and Theoretical Analysis (3 papers), Point processes and geometric inequalities (3 papers), Finite Group Theory Research (2 papers), Algebraic and Geometric Analysis (1 paper), Wind and Air Flow Studies (1 paper) and Advanced Mathematical Theories and Applications (1 paper). The work is most often cited by research in Computer Graphics and Computer-Aided Design (19 citations), Applied Mathematics (45 citations), Geometry and Topology (33 citations), Theoretical Computer Science (2 citations) and Discrete Mathematics and Combinatorics (4 citations). Andrew Sobczyk has collaborated with scholars based in United States and Poland. Frequent co-authors include Preston C. Hammer and Ziemowit Malecha. Their work appears in journals such as Proceedings of the American Mathematical Society, Bulletin of the American Mathematical Society, Canadian Journal of Mathematics, Pacific Journal of Mathematics and American Mathematical Monthly.
